Transaction 59a59764d3c4e7a3c32c8c42ac5a27e5c018015ec753f9275f206623e438f34e

4 Input
2 Outputs
  • 59a59764d3c4e7a3c32c8c42ac5a27e5c018015ec753f9275f206623e438f34e:0
  • value  588568
    address  3AMkSPtDqbevZws49g7mNsgJfDSnn2shZL
  • 59a59764d3c4e7a3c32c8c42ac5a27e5c018015ec753f9275f206623e438f34e:1
  • value  360000
    address  1BdagDqoUc2iodL92r5wXNLQjamomnzjwo